I have a E320cdi Auto 2001 w210 with 75k miles on clock.

Car is mainly used at weekends, and I have noticed now that every time I use, the following symptoms.


* Will not change up gear above 3rd? I think.
* Speed limiter or cruise control when activated via stalk gives a beep and malfunction in Speedtronic fault message is displayed in message centre.
* Tip tronic in gear box + ,or - does not work


If I pull over and turn off engine and restart the fault goes away.

Can any one help me on this ? all tips very welcome.

Had this problem on our 2000 E320 CDi. Turned out to be the conductor plate in the auto box (the conductor plate contains some of the electronics). Cost £500 to fix but that included new fluid and filter (which I was going to do anyway).
